package tests
import (
"testing"
"github.com/ncruces/go-sqlite3"
"github.com/ncruces/go-sqlite3/driver"
_ "github.com/ncruces/go-sqlite3/embed"
_ "github.com/ncruces/go-sqlite3/internal/testcfg"
"github.com/ncruces/go-sqlite3/vfs/memdb"
)
func TestDriver(t *testing.T) {
t.Parallel()
tmp := memdb.TestDB(t)
db, err := driver.Open(tmp, nil, func(c *sqlite3.Conn) error {
return c.Exec(`PRAGMA optimize`)
})
if err != nil {
t.Fatal(err)
}
defer db.Close()
conn, err := db.Conn(t.Context())
if err != nil {
t.Fatal(err)
}
defer conn.Close()
res, err := conn.ExecContext(t.Context(),
`CREATE TABLE users (id INTEGER PRIMARY KEY NOT NULL, name VARCHAR(10))`)
if err != nil {
t.Fatal(err)
}
changes, err := res.RowsAffected()
if err != nil {
t.Fatal(err)
}
if changes != 0 {
t.Errorf("got %d want 0", changes)
}
id, err := res.LastInsertId()
if err != nil {
t.Fatal(err)
}
if id != 0 {
t.Errorf("got %d want 0", changes)
}
res, err = conn.ExecContext(t.Context(),
`INSERT INTO users (id, name) VALUES (0, 'go'), (1, 'zig'), (2, 'whatever')`)
if err != nil {
t.Fatal(err)
}
changes, err = res.RowsAffected()
if err != nil {
t.Fatal(err)
}
if changes != 3 {
t.Errorf("got %d want 3", changes)
}
stmt, err := conn.PrepareContext(t.Context(),
`SELECT id, name FROM users`)
if err != nil {
t.Fatal(err)
}
defer stmt.Close()
rows, err := stmt.Query()
if err != nil {
t.Fatal(err)
}
defer rows.Close()
typs, err := rows.ColumnTypes()
if err != nil {
t.Fatal(err)
}
if got := typs[0].DatabaseTypeName(); got != "INTEGER" {
t.Errorf("got %s, want INTEGER", got)
}
if got := typs[1].DatabaseTypeName(); got != "VARCHAR" {
t.Errorf("got %s, want VARCHAR", got)
}
if got, ok := typs[0].Nullable(); got || !ok {
t.Errorf("got %v/%v, want false/true", got, ok)
}
if got, ok := typs[1].Nullable(); !got || ok {
t.Errorf("got %v/%v, want true/false", got, ok)
}
row := 0
ids := []int{0, 1, 2}
names := []string{"go", "zig", "whatever"}
for ; rows.Next(); row++ {
var id int
var name string
err := rows.Scan(&id, &name)
if err != nil {
t.Fatal(err)
}
if id != ids[row] {
t.Errorf("got %d, want %d", id, ids[row])
}
if name != names[row] {
t.Errorf("got %q, want %q", name, names[row])
}
}
if row != 3 {
t.Errorf("got %d, want %d", row, len(ids))
}
err = rows.Close()
if err != nil {
t.Fatal(err)
}
err = stmt.Close()
if err != nil {
t.Fatal(err)
}
err = conn.Close()
if err != nil {
t.Fatal(err)
}
err = db.Close()
if err != nil {
t.Fatal(err)
}
}
